Output 31e4533e4155b74e50e87a5be1f3b25f509c66d68ab140280572b33b84312db9:4

value
129097508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0d27cba25a9c493d1938b8a059c78b477bcaafb OP_EQUAL
address
3GMNC9M9fDRgmNB62nHbcA9wfWfGujEwCs
transaction
31e4533e4155b74e50e87a5be1f3b25f509c66d68ab140280572b33b84312db9
spent
true